The Power of Collective Insights

Have you ever marveled at how a singular idea can branch out into a multitude of interpretations online? It’s truly fascinating to witness discussions unfold, peeling back layers of meaning that might be overlooked in a solitary reading. Social media reshapes our engagement with scripture, creating communities around shared interpretations that spark dynamic exchanges of thoughts.

For example, I recall one memorable post that ignited a lively discussion on the Book of Revelation. What had once seemed like an ominous text became illuminated through the diverse perspectives of various readers. They shed light on how these ancient prophecies could speak to pressing contemporary issues such as social justice, environmental challenges, and the ongoing quest for peace. The collaborative spirit of these discussions often left me feeling uplifted and more intertwined with my faith.

    Of course, with the democratization of knowledge also comes the risk of misinterpretation. I’ve stumbled upon posts that seemed to completely twist the meanings of Biblical messages. It can be disheartening to see how misinformation spreads like wildfire online, leading to confusion rather than clarification. Yet therein lies the beauty of community: together, we can sift through the misunderstandings to uncover deeper truths.

    I remember coming across a popular video that misrepresented essential themes of hope and love within scripture. Initially, I felt a wave of frustration. However, as comments began to roll in, I observed community members gently challenging this narrative. They referenced scripture and provided context, encouraging a more accurate understanding. This collective response not only clarified the intended message but also cultivated a valuable environment for learning and growth. I realized just how much we can lean on each other’s wisdom in the vast sea of information circulating on social media.
